ROTH and Missing - Team Manager

 

North Somerset Council 

 

Managing a multi-disciplinary team and work at an operational and strategic level in partnership with other professionals, to implement and develop ROTH services for children across North Somerset, ensuring that there is a strong and effective response to children missing and those at risk of contextual harm.  This will include the efficient deployment of resources according to need and management of associated budgets as needed.  

Key Responsibilities:
Coordination, development and planning of services to children and young people and their parents / carers delivered across the local authorities within the Avon and Somerset Police area to reduce the impact of risk outside the family home and crime on them and improve their life chances

Lead the implementation of Risk Outside the Home (ROTH) and contextual safeguarding responses across North Somerset-Including workforce development and partnership based responses to Risk outside the Home 

Manage and review contracts, grants and bids for commissioning services or funding in support of identified service provision and work closely with partners and stakeholders to design, manage and deliver services against agreed priorities.

Research, develop and recommend strategies for improved service delivery and ensure agreed objectives are reflected in service and individual plans.

Represent Children’s services at professional meetings, creating and maintaining effective working relationships with others to achieve improved outcomes for children and young people and the council's objectives.
